Notice

1. Please read user manual carefully before operating the device.

2. Please use the power adaptor accompanied with this product. Warranty

does not cover for damages caused by pairing other power adaptor.

3. Please check all connecting devices are properly grounded to avoid

electric failure.

4. This product has limited warranty for one year from defects in material and

workmanship. Items that are physically damaged, misused, tempered with

or altered are void of warranty. For further details please contact your

distributor. In case warranty sticker is damaged or missing, warranty is void.

For further details please contact your distributor.

5. If your HDMI (DVI) device requires an EDID present, you can use an EDID

Reader/Writer to provide HDMI (DVI) EDID information.

6. All of the transmission distances are measured by using Belden Cat.5e

125MHz cables and PlayStation3 as the HDMI source.

7. To reduce the interference among the unshielded twisted pairs of wires in

Cat.5/5e/6 cable, you can use shielded Cat.5/5e/6 cables to improve EMI

problems, which is worsen in the long transmission.

8. Because the quality of the Cat.5/5e/6 cables has the major effects in how

long transmission distance and how good the picture quality may be, the

actual transmission length is subject to your Cat.5/5e/6 cables. For

resolution greater than 1080i or 1280x1024, a Cat.6 cable is recommended.
